デバイスビルド情報

public class DeviceBuildInfo
extends BuildInfo implements IDeviceBuildInfo

java.lang.オブジェクト
com.android.tradefed.build.BuildInfo
com.android.tradefed.build.DeviceBuildInfo


完全な Android デバイスのビルドと (オプションで) そのテストを表すIBuildInfo

まとめ

パブリックコンストラクター

DeviceBuildInfo ()
DeviceBuildInfo (String buildId, String buildTargetName)
DeviceBuildInfo ( BuildInfo buildInfo)

パブリックメソッド

File getBasebandImageFile ()

ローカルのベースバンド イメージ ファイルを取得します。

String getBasebandVersion ()

ベースバンドのバージョンを取得します。

File getBootloaderImageFile ()

ローカルのブートローダー イメージ ファイルを取得します。

String getBootloaderVersion ()

ブートローダーのバージョンを取得します。

String getDeviceBuildFlavor ()

テスト対象のプラットフォーム ビルドのタイプを返すオプションのメソッド。

String getDeviceBuildId ()

テスト対象のプラットフォーム ビルドの一意の識別子を返します。

File getDeviceImageFile ()

ローカルデバイスイメージのzipファイルを取得します。

String getDeviceImageVersion ()

ローカル デバイス イメージの zip バージョンを取得します。

File getMkbootimgFile ()

カーネル イメージの作成に使用される mkbootimg ファイルを取得します。

String getMkbootimgVersion ()

mkbootimg のバージョンを取得します。

File getOtaPackageFile ()

デバイスの OTA パッケージ zip ファイルを取得します。

String getOtaPackageVersion ()

デバイスの OTA パッケージの zip バージョンを取得します。

File getRamdiskFile ()

カーネル イメージの作成に使用される RAM ディスク ファイルを取得します。

String getRamdiskVersion ()

RAMディスクのバージョンを取得します。

File getTestsDir ()

抽出されたtests.zipファイルの内容へのローカルパスを取得します。

String getTestsDirVersion ()

抽出したtests.zipバージョンを取得します。

File getUserDataImageFile ()

ローカルのテスト ユーザーデータ イメージ ファイルを取得します。

String getUserDataImageVersion ()

ローカルのテスト ユーザーデータ イメージのバージョンを取得します。

void setBasebandImage (File basebandFile, String version)

デバイス ビルドのベースバンド イメージを設定します。

void setBootloaderImageFile (File bootloaderImgFile, String version)

デバイス ビルドのブートローダー イメージを設定します。

void setDeviceBuildFlavor (String deviceBuildFlavor)

IBuildInfo.setBuildFlavor(String)と異なる場合は、ビルド情報のデバイス部分のビルドフレーバーを設定します。

void setDeviceImageFile (File deviceImageFile, String version)

使用するデバイスのシステムイメージファイルを設定します。

void setMkbootimgFile (File mkbootimg, String version)

カーネルイメージの作成に使用される mkbootimg ファイルを設定します。

void setOtaPackageFile (File otaFile, String version)

デバイスの OTA パッケージ zip ファイルを設定します。

void setRamdiskFile (File ramdisk, String version)

カーネル イメージの作成に使用される RAM ディスク ファイルを取得します。

void setTestsDir (File testsDir, String version)

抽出したtests.zipファイルの内容へのローカルパスを設定します。

void setUserDataImageFile (File userDataFile, String version)

使用するユーザーデータイメージファイルを設定します。

パブリックコンストラクター

デバイスビルド情報

public DeviceBuildInfo ()

デバイスビルド情報

public DeviceBuildInfo (String buildId, 
                String buildTargetName)

パラメーター
buildId String

buildTargetName String

デバイスビルド情報

public DeviceBuildInfo (BuildInfo buildInfo)

パラメーター
buildInfo BuildInfo

パブリックメソッド

getBasebandImageFile

public File getBasebandImageFile ()

ローカルのベースバンド イメージ ファイルを取得します。

戻り値
File

getBasebandVersion

public String getBasebandVersion ()

ベースバンドのバージョンを取得します。

戻り値
String

getBootloaderImageFile

public File getBootloaderImageFile ()

ローカルのブートローダー イメージ ファイルを取得します。

戻り値
File

ブートローダーのバージョンの取得

public String getBootloaderVersion ()

ブートローダーのバージョンを取得します。

戻り値
String

getDeviceBuildFlavor

public String getDeviceBuildFlavor ()

テスト対象のプラットフォーム ビルドのタイプを返すオプションのメソッド。

戻り値
String

getDeviceBuildId

public String getDeviceBuildId ()

テスト対象のプラットフォーム ビルドの一意の識別子を返します。決して null であってはなりません。デフォルトはIBuildInfo.UNKNOWN_BUILD_IDです。

戻り値
String getDeviceImageVersion() nullでない場合、それ以外の場合はIBuildInfo#UNKNOWN_BUILD_ID

以下も参照してください。

getデバイスイメージファイル

public File getDeviceImageFile ()

ローカルデバイスイメージのzipファイルを取得します。

戻り値
File

getDeviceImageVersion

public String getDeviceImageVersion ()

ローカル デバイス イメージの zip バージョンを取得します。

戻り値
String

getMkbootimgFile

public File getMkbootimgFile ()

カーネル イメージの作成に使用される mkbootimg ファイルを取得します。

戻り値
File

getMkbootimgVersion

public String getMkbootimgVersion ()

mkbootimg のバージョンを取得します。

戻り値
String

getOtaPackageFile

public File getOtaPackageFile ()

デバイスの OTA パッケージ zip ファイルを取得します。

戻り値
File

getOtaPackageVersion

public String getOtaPackageVersion ()

デバイスの OTA パッケージの zip バージョンを取得します。

戻り値
String

getRamdiskFile

public File getRamdiskFile ()

カーネル イメージの作成に使用される RAM ディスク ファイルを取得します。

戻り値
File

ラムディスクのバージョンの取得

public String getRamdiskVersion ()

RAMディスクのバージョンを取得します。

戻り値
String

getTestsDir

public File getTestsDir ()

抽出されたtests.zipファイルの内容へのローカルパスを取得します。

戻り値
File

getTestsDirVersion

public String getTestsDirVersion ()

抽出したtests.zipバージョンを取得します。

戻り値
String

getUserDataImageFile

public File getUserDataImageFile ()

ローカルのテスト ユーザーデータ イメージ ファイルを取得します。

戻り値
File

getUserDataImageVersion

public String getUserDataImageVersion ()

ローカルのテスト ユーザーデータ イメージのバージョンを取得します。

戻り値
String

setBasebandImage

public void setBasebandImage (File basebandFile, 
                String version)

デバイス ビルドのベースバンド イメージを設定します。

パラメーター
basebandFile File : ベースバンド画像ERROR(/File)

version String : ベースバンドのバージョン

setBootloaderImageFile

public void setBootloaderImageFile (File bootloaderImgFile, 
                String version)

デバイス ビルドのブートローダー イメージを設定します。

パラメーター
bootloaderImgFile File : ブートローダー イメージERROR(/File)

version String : ブートローダーのバージョン

setDeviceBuildFlavor

public void setDeviceBuildFlavor (String deviceBuildFlavor)

IBuildInfo.setBuildFlavor(String)と異なる場合は、ビルド情報のデバイス部分のビルドフレーバーを設定します。

パラメーター
deviceBuildFlavor String : デバイス ビルドのフレーバー

setDeviceImageFile

public void setDeviceImageFile (File deviceImageFile, 
                String version)

使用するデバイスのシステムイメージファイルを設定します。

パラメーター
version String

setMkbootimgFile

public void setMkbootimgFile (File mkbootimg, 
                String version)

カーネルイメージの作成に使用される mkbootimg ファイルを設定します。

パラメーター
mkbootimg File

version String

setOtaPackageFile

public void setOtaPackageFile (File otaFile, 
                String version)

デバイスの OTA パッケージ zip ファイルを設定します。

パラメーター
otaFile File

version String

setRamdiskFile

public void setRamdiskFile (File ramdisk, 
                String version)

カーネル イメージの作成に使用される RAM ディスク ファイルを取得します。

パラメーター
ramdisk File

version String

setTestsDir

public void setTestsDir (File testsDir, 
                String version)

抽出したtests.zipファイルの内容へのローカルパスを設定します。

パラメーター
version String

setUserDataImageFile

public void setUserDataImageFile (File userDataFile, 
                String version)

使用するユーザーデータイメージファイルを設定します。

パラメーター
version String